[Nix-dev] Gnash and buildfarm.

Michael Raskin 7c6f434c at mail.ru
Wed Oct 15 22:37:52 CEST 2008


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

		Hello.
	I noticed the following:
	1. Buildfarm trunk build fails over and over again.
	2. The only two packages from build-for-release that fail are updated
Gnash packages.
	3. The real build failure is DejaGNU. I understand that the problem is
in its test suite (relevant log lines are in the end of the message).
The failure occurs on both i686 and amd64 architectures.
	
	So, does anybody know what exactly is failing and how to fix it? Just
right now I disabled gnash in build-for-release just to get a MANIFEST
from buildfarm. I am going to re-enable gnash build afterwards, if I
forget to do it, someone please fix it.. I have launched a dejagnu build
to investigate a bit further. Ludovic, as you are GNU insider (and
author of both Gnash and DejaGNU expressions), I hope you have some
advice to give..

Raskin

		===  tests ===

Schedule of variations:
    unix

Running target unix
Using
/tmp/nix-build-bgff3w9cjk0ir6dsjmarlbq5cisfp7ll-dejagnu-1.4.4.drv-0/dejagnu-1.4.4/testsuite/../config/base-config.exp
as tool-and-target-specific interface file.
Using
/tmp/nix-build-bgff3w9cjk0ir6dsjmarlbq5cisfp7ll-dejagnu-1.4.4.drv-0/dejagnu-1.4.4/testsuite/config/default.exp
as tool-and-target-specific interface file.
Running
/tmp/nix-build-bgff3w9cjk0ir6dsjmarlbq5cisfp7ll-dejagnu-1.4.4.drv-0/dejagnu-1.4.4/testsuite/libdejagnu/tunit.exp
...
send: spawn id exp0 not open
    while executing
"send_user "$message\n""
    ("default" arm line 2)
    invoked from within
"case "$firstword" in {
	{"PASS:" "XFAIL:" "KFAIL:" "UNRESOLVED:" "UNSUPPORTED:" "UNTESTED:"} {
	    if $all_flag {
		send_user "$message\n"
		return "..."
    (procedure "clone_output" line 10)
    invoked from within
"clone_output "Running $test_file_name ...""
    (procedure "runtest" line 9)
    invoked from within
"runtest $test_name"
    ("foreach" body line 42)
    invoked from within
"foreach test_name [lsort [find ${dir} *.exp]] {
			if { ${test_name} == "" } {
			    continue
			}
			# Ignore this one if asked to.
			if { ${ignore..."
    ("foreach" body line 54)
    invoked from within
"foreach dir "${test_top_dirs}" {
		if { ${dir} != ${srcdir} } {
		    # Ignore this directory if is a directory to be
		    # ignored.
		    if {[info..."
    ("foreach" body line 121)
    invoked from within
"foreach pass $multipass {

	# multipass_name is set for `record_test' to use (see framework.exp).
	if { [lindex $pass 0] != "" } {
	    set multipass_..."
    ("foreach" body line 51)
    invoked from within
"foreach current_target $target_list {
    verbose "target is $current_target"
    set current_target_name $current_target
    set tlist [split $curren..."
    (file "../runtest.exp" line 1625)
make[5]: *** [check-DEJAGNU] Error 1
make[5]: Leaving directory
`/tmp/nix-build-bgff3w9cjk0ir6dsjmarlbq5cisfp7ll-dejagnu-1.4.4.drv-0/dejagnu-1.4.4/testsuite'
make[4]: *** [check-am] Error 2
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.9 (GNU/Linux)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org

iQEcBAEBAgAGBQJI9lSYAAoJEE6tnN0aWvw3hQ0H/1cvxdg+D8v782Y1SCQXqOgN
OCXlpZuqzes0z9NNilSURTzZLYC2OHb5LFbEcd9N/CNAAuWIPLTPsYUN+StFrWlY
vpbbrYeBqX9b65A7Ow+yODhV+mgALhPp1WPAaO2yhWzKKTkY81Erm0MqAQeJuftS
IfKfXS+LU+8DP2p14rFm1l5bjG9KsKkh3psSy94GSMnosC39HJXakguUbHR5ZZFG
89nHaEqkRB7glSsmbxWbFYvynSoOoP9QnovPdZeRXXvuarEHTuFMgman3iN61gte
ocl3i1HVcQ5eXOHZuOOMAjZOM230siB/Noxikqc35L3cgKYht14jStu4ieyGxRY=
=Jwif
-----END PGP SIGNATURE-----



More information about the nix-dev mailing list